woman [uo-man]
sustantivo
1Mujer, criatura racional del sexo femenino. (plural)
  • A beautiful woman -> una hermosa mujer
  • You’re a lucky woman -> tienes suerte
2La porción femenina de la raza humana; las mujeres colectivamente.
3Carácter mujeril, el conjunto de las propiedades peculiares a las mujeres.
4Mujer, criada, sirvienta.
  • Woman of the town -> dama cortesana
(pl. WOMEN).

woman [ˈwʊmən]
noun
women (plural) [ˈwɪmɪn] mujer; (f)
woman is very different from man la mujer es muy distinta del hombre; I have a woman who comes in to do the cleaning tengo una mujer que me hace la limpieza; the woman in his life su compañera; his woman (informal) (lover) su querida; woman to woman de mujer a mujer
women's doublesdoubles dobles femeninos; (m)
women's footballfootball fútbol femenino; (m)
women's groupgroup grupo femenino; (m)
women's liblib (informal) la liberación de la mujer
women's libberlibber (informal) feminista; (m)
women's liberationliberation (old-fashioned) liberación de la mujer; (f)
women's movementmovement movimiento feminista; (m)
